About this plant

Standing as the 155th largest hydroelectric power generation facility in Canada, Twin Falls (Iron Ore) boasts a capacity of 225 MW, contributing approximately 0.12% to the nation’s total hydroelectric output. Canada is renowned for its reliance on hydroelectric power, with 1,334 plants generating a combined capacity of 193,190 MW, making hydro the dominant fuel source. Twin Falls is particularly unique, as it is isolated with no nearby plants within a 50 km radius, emphasizing its significance in the local energy landscape. The plant utilizes the kinetic energy of flowing water to generate electricity, a hallmark of hydro technology that capitalizes on the region’s abundant freshwater resources.
